Useful preparation checklist
- Sort items into keep, move, store, and dispose piles
- Pack boxes securely and avoid overfilling them
- Wrap fragile items with suitable protection
- Label boxes by room or priority
- Measure large furniture and check doorways, stairs, and lifts
- Confirm parking or loading access at both addresses
- Keep essentials, documents, and valuables separate
- Disassemble furniture if needed before the move
Pricing Factors to Consider
Customers often want to know what affects the cost of a removal truck hire service. While exact prices depend on the vehicle, duration, distance, and the nature of the move, there are several common factors that influence the overall cost. Understanding them can help you choose the right option and avoid paying for more than you need.
Vehicle size is one of the biggest factors. A larger move requires more space, while a smaller job may only need a compact vehicle. Duration matters as well, because a half-day hire is different from a full-day or longer booking. Distance can also affect the arrangement, particularly if you are moving beyond Barking or making multiple stops.
Other considerations include the time of the move, how much loading and unloading is required, whether there are stairs or difficult access points, and whether the route involves busy areas where parking time may be limited. If you need to move large, awkward, or fragile items, that can also affect the planning. Frequently Asked Questions
What size truck do I need for my move?
The best size depends on how much you are moving, the kind of items involved, and how many trips you want to avoid. A small flat move may need less space than a family house move or an office relocation. If you are unsure, it is best to describe the items and the property layout when asking for a quote.
Can I hire a truck for just a few items?
Yes. Many customers only need a truck for large furniture, appliances, or a few bulky items that will not fit in a car. This is often a practical choice if you are collecting something from another part of East London or moving a single room’s contents.
Is removal truck hire suitable for flats in Barking?
Yes, and in many cases it is especially useful for flats. Barking has many apartment buildings and developments where parking or access can be tricky. A truck gives you the capacity to complete the move efficiently, though it is wise to plan around lift access, stairs, and loading areas.
Do I need to pack everything before the truck arrives?
Ideally, yes. The more prepared your belongings are, the faster and smoother the move will be. Boxes should be sealed, fragile items protected, and furniture either disassembled or ready to move safely. Good preparation makes loading far easier.
